Market Overview:
The global display driver IC for TVs market is expected to grow at a CAGR of 5.5% during the forecast period from 2018 to 2030. The growth in this market can be attributed to the increasing demand for 4K2K TVs and the growing adoption of smart TVs. In terms of type, the HDTV segment is expected to hold the largest share of the global display driver IC for TVs market during the forecast period. This can be attributed to factors such as declining prices of HDTVs and their growing popularity among consumers across regions.
Product Definition:
Display driver IC for TVs refers to a chip that is responsible for driving the display panel in televisions. This chip is important because it determines the quality and accuracy of the images displayed on the screen. Without a good display driver IC, images on TV screens may be distorted or show artifacts.

Growth Factors:
- Increasing demand for large-sized TVs: The global demand for large-sized TVs is increasing due to the growing trend of home cinema and the rising disposable income of consumers. This is expected to drive the growth of the Display Driver IC market for TVs during the forecast period.
- Growing popularity of 4K and 8K displays: 4K and 8K displays are becoming increasingly popular, owing to their superior picture quality as compared to traditional HD displays. This is expected to boost the demand for Display Driver ICs in TV applications during the forecast period.
- Proliferation of smart TVs: Smart TVs are gaining traction among consumers due to their enhanced features such as internet connectivity, voice recognition, and motion sensing capabilities. This is anticipated to fuel growth in demand for Display Driver ICs used in TV applications during the forecast period.
